Before you get too industrious with the dremmel, realize a RAS alone, weighing in at 11.3 oz., on an Hbar
is going to be hefty. Add a light, VFG or whatever warrants putting on a rail, a red dot on top and you have a handfull. I sent my RRA Hbar to ADCO and had them turn it down to med. weight under the HG and with a RAS it now balances beautifully. |
